CVE-2026-8933

snap-confine

Descripción

A local privilege escalation vulnerability exists in snap-confine, a set-capabilities core component used internally by Canonical snapd to construct the secure execution environment for snap applications. This vulnerability uniquely affects versions of snap-confine configured with set-capabilities (rather than standard set-uid-root installations). Due to a flaw in how privilege boundaries or security sandboxes are initialized when the binary runs under limited ambient capabilities, a local, unprivileged attacker can exploit this behavior to bypass intended restrictions and execute arbitrary code. Successful exploitation allows the local user to elevate their privileges to full root authority.
